Common Materials Used for Pipe Relining
There are many types of materials that can be used in pipe relining, and each material has its own advantages. Epoxy resin is one of the most prevalent ones. This material dries fast and adheses well to the existing pipes forming a robust inner lining.
Fiberglass is another common selection. Fiberglass is also known to be strong and flexible and can be used in different shapes and sizes of the pipes and remains resistant to corrosion.
Polyester resin is also introduced to this sphere. It is quite beneficial to smaller projects because it can be cost-effective and is not complicated to implement.
Felt liners impregnated with resin are also in common use. Once they are installed, they provide an excellent structural support, and they can be used to support small imperfections on the host pipe.
The materials have their intended purpose depending on the nature of the piping system (or environmental conditions). Knowledge of such options is useful in decision making when choosing supplies to use in any pipe relining project.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Pipe Relining Supplies
A number of factors are considered when choosing the supplies of pipe relining. The first and the foremost thing is the kind of pipes you are dealing with. Certain materials need certain linings to make sure that they are adhered and have long life.
The second one is the diameter of the pipes. The fitting is a right that ensures an easy installation process that is important to achieve the best outcome.
Another useful factor is the cure time of the material. Rapidly curing products can be used to conserve time but do not necessarily have the durability of slow curing materials.
Also, consider the environmental conditions. Humidity or temperature variation could have an impact on the performance of various products in the long term.
